Rare Wolf Capital LLC Invests $15.92 Million in Alphabet Inc. $GOOG

Rare Wolf Capital LLC bought a new position in Alphabet Inc. (NASDAQ:GOOGFree Report) during the fourth quarter, Holdings Channel reports. The fund bought 50,719 shares of the information services provider’s stock, valued at approximately $15,916,000. Alphabet comprises about 9.9% of Rare Wolf Capital LLC’s holdings, making the stock its largest position.

Alphabet Trading Up 1.5%

NASDAQ:GOOG opened at $367.46 on Friday.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.16, a current ratio of 1.92 and a quick ratio of 1.92. Alphabet Inc. has a fifty-two week low of $163.33 and a fifty-two week high of $404.47. The stock’s 50-day moving average is $363.25 and its two-hundred day moving average is $330.81. The stock has a market cap of $4.45 trillion, a PE ratio of 28.03, a price-to-earnings-growth ratio of 1.55 and a beta of 1.22.

Alphabet (NASDAQ:GOOGGet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ings results on Thursday, April 30th. The information services provider reported $5.11 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of $2.68 by $2.43. The business had revenue of $109.90 billion during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$106.96 billion. Alphabet had a net margin of 37.92% and a return on equity of 38.99%. The firm’s revenue was up 21.8%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same period in the prior year, the firm earned $2.81 earnings per share. As a group, equities research analysts forecast that Alphabet Inc. will post 14.3 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

Alphabet Increases Dividend

The business also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Monday, June 15th. Shareholders of record on Monday, June 8th were paid a $0.22 dividend. The ex-dividend date was Monday, June 8th. This represents a $0.88 annualized dividend and a yield of 0.2%. This is a boost from Alphabet’s previous quarterly dividend of $0.21. Alphabet’s dividend payout ratio (DPR) is currently 6.71%.

About Alphabet

(Free Report)

Alphabet Inc (NASDAQ: GOOG) is a multinational technology holding company headquartered in Mountain View, California. Formed in 2015 through a corporate restructuring of Google, Alphabet serves as the parent to Google LLC and a portfolio of businesses collectively known as “Other Bets.” Google was originally founded in 1998 by Larry Page and Sergey Brin; Alphabet is led by CEO Sundar Pichai, who oversees Google and the broader company while the founders remain prominent shareholders and influential figures in the company’s history.

Alphabet’s core business centers on internet search and advertising, with Google Search and the company’s ad platforms (including Google Ads and AdSense) generating the majority of revenue by connecting advertisers with consumers worldwide.
